Elijah again… when making an album, do you have a set selection of instruments you try to stay within? every song in the party and the neon skyline just seems to suit each-other so well and fits to make the the stories feel even more cohesive. Just wondered if this was something you decide before going into your recording process? Thanks

Yeah I find if there are too many options that it can be overwhelming trying to decide on what is going to do the job best. If you only have a few tools to do the job you’re going to end up finding some creative ways to get it done.
